About

Sara Tinsley is a scholar working on Hematology, Genetics and Oncology. According to data from OpenAlex, Sara Tinsley has authored 51 papers receiving a total of 445 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 38 papers in Hematology, 22 papers in Genetics and 7 papers in Oncology. Recurrent topics in Sara Tinsley’s work include Acute Myeloid Leukemia Research (27 papers), Chronic Myeloid Leukemia Treatments (11 papers) and Chronic Lymphocytic Leukemia Research (11 papers). Sara Tinsley is often cited by papers focused on Acute Myeloid Leukemia Research (27 papers), Chronic Myeloid Leukemia Treatments (11 papers) and Chronic Lymphocytic Leukemia Research (11 papers). Sara Tinsley collaborates with scholars based in United States, Italy and Canada. Sara Tinsley's co-authors include Jeffrey E. Lancet, Rami S. Komrokji, Sandra Kurtin, Alan F. List, Eric Padron, Javier Pinilla‐Ibarz, Kendra Sweet, Eduardo M. Sotomayor, David P. Steensma and Paul B. Jacobsen and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, Blood and Clinical Cancer Research.
